Transcribed Image Text:1- a) Calculate the planar atomic density in atoms per square milimeter for (110) crystal plane in FCC gold, which has the atomic radius of 0.1442 nm. b) Calculate the atomic packing factor for a metal that has a cubic unit cell with a lattice parameter of 0.288 nm, density of 7.20 gr/cm³, and an atomic weigth of 52.0 g/mole.
